RealSight DT Digital Twin Scene Modeling Platform is an all-in-one 2D and 3D scene modeling tool based on the B/S architecture. It supports multiple file formats for models and automatic lightweighting of models. It also enables visual configuration with data binding, animations, and interactions. Real-time data interaction is supported, and it seamlessly integrates with IoT platforms, data analytics platforms, and knowledge graph platforms. With low-code development, it enables fast implementation of data visualization, simulation, VR, and other applications.
RealSight DT integrates data-driven, model-driven, and knowledge-driven approaches to provide a convenient and comprehensive digital twin platform for smart manufacturing.
RealSight DT enables automated decimation of model, including texture processing, decimating a 500M model to just 5M. It solves the high cost and long cycle issues associated with model lightweighting in the industry.
RealSight DT utilizes an independent and controllable technical system that can adapt flexibly to different requirements. It supports elastic scalability and is compatible with various data interfaces. It also supports integration and expansion with existing business systems.
